Going strictly by PER this past season:
1. Dwayne Wade - 21.79
2. Michael Redd - 19.06
2. Vince Carter - 19.06
4. Jason Richardson - 18.66
5. Rip Hamilton - 18.41
6. Mike Dunleavy - 17.54
7. Joe Johnson - 17.5
8. Ben Gordon - 16.65
9. Ray Allen - 16.59
10. Jamal Crawford - 16.17
Notables:
Josh Childress - 18.02
Andre Igoudala - 19.24
